Carnival Sunshine Review
Review of Carnival Sunshine
Built in 1996 for US$409 million, Carnival Sunshine was initially named Carnival Destiny. After a major refurbishment in 2013 which cost US$155 million, the ship was renamed Sunshine. As passenger ship class, Carnival Sunshine was the first of three Carnival Destiny-class sisterships - together with Victory-Radiance and Triumph-Sunrise. Today, the vessel belongs to the unique Sunshine-class.

Cruise itinerary program
Carnival Sunshine itinerary program is based on Western and Eastern Caribbean roundtrip cruises from Port Canaveral, Florida. Feature port destinations include Bahamas (with Nassau and line’s private island Half Moon Cay), Puerto Rico, Saint Thomas, Grand Turk, Roatan, Belize, Mexico (Costa Maya and Cozumel). Starting in 2016, the ship offers Bermuda cruises with a 7-day itinerary from New York and 5-day itinerary from Norfolk VA.
Starting May 2019, the ship's new itinerary program offers 4- (to Nassau) and 5-day (Nassau and Half Moon Cay) short Bahamas cruises leaving roundtrip from a new homeport (Charleston SC) on a year-round schedule. The maiden voyage was scheduled for May 18 (2019). The Carnival's South Carolina annual cruise shipping volume is approx 220,000 passengers. In Charleston, Carnival Sunshine will replace Carnival Ecstasy (to be relocated to Jacksonville Florida), while the Jacksonville-homeported Carnival Elation will be repositioned to Port Canaveral FL.
Cabins
Carnival Sunshine has a total number of 1506 cabins (of which 55 Suites) in 32 grades. Most Carnival Sunshine staterooms are 185-sq. foot insides (586), oceanview (342) and suite (55). Sunshine also has 89 Cloud 9 Spa cabins and 32 wheelchair accessible cabins. The number of ship's cabin categories is 34. Sunshine's Captain’s Suites are the largest cabins onboard (500 sq.feet) and can accommodate up to five passengers. They feature master bedroom, dressing area, large bathroom, separate living room, separate bathroom, fridge, and mini-bar. Suite guests benefit from VIP check-in.
Shipboard dining options - Food and Drinks
Carnival Sunshine offers many of the Fun Ship 2.0 additions in terms of dining - Guy's Burger Joint, Cucina del Capitano, BlueIguana Cantina. The line made a few adjustments to the existing venues and also added the outstanding specialty restaurant, Ji Ji. There are two Main Dining Rooms onboard the Sunshine: Sunset, at the midship, and double-deck Sunrise located aft. The complimentary Punchliner Comedy Brunch, which is a sea day exclusive, features 5-minute teasers every hour on the hour from 9 am to 1:30 pm.
Follows the complete list of Carnival Sunshine restaurants and food bars.
- Sunset Restaurant (forward Main Dining Room, with two fixed dinner seatings, or “Your Time Dining”)
- Sunrise Restaurant (aft Main Dining Room, with two fixed dinner seatings; offers themed breakfasts - “Seuss At Sea”, for $5 cover charge; hosts Punchliner Comedy Brunch).
- Fahrenheit 555 Steakhouse (alternative, reservations only restaurant, serving prime steaks and seafood at a surcharge; also hosts “Chef’s Table” VIP dining, $75 PP surcharge)
- Fat Jimmy’s C-Side BBQ (offers pork sandwiches, complimentary lunch barbecue)
- Guy’s Burger Joint (fast food bar)
- BlueIguana Cantina (Mexican complimentary restaurant; offers house-made tortillas, burritos, tacos)
- Lido Marketplace buffet restaurant (complimentary self-service restaurant with various food stations; operates as a bistro in the evenings).
- Cucina del Capitano (Italian reservations-only restaurant; offers a la carte dinner at a surcharge and complimentary lunch)
- SeaDogs (complimentary beef hotdogs stand)
- Ji Ji Asian Kitchen (serves Chinese food, Mongolian Wok)
- Bonsai Sushi Bar (complimentary).
Shipboard entertainment options - Fun and Sport
Carnival made a heavy investment in lights and sound for its shows on Carnival Breeze and has taken a step further on Sunshine. An ultra-HD graphics package is beamed onto a vast screen and the performers use it as a backdrop of their show. A number of themed shows take place in ship's Liquid Lounge, which doubles as the 800-seat main Theater. Because the room was initially designed as a theater with two stories, it's impossible to feature an intimate atmosphere.
The Sunshine ship offers a complete list of activities and entertainment for each age group and taste - from ballroom scene dancing, classical music concerts, tea time and art auctions to a hairy chest and knobby knees contests, bingo, and karaoke.

Carnival Sunshine Wiki
Fun Ship 2.0 upgrade was done in 2013. Sunshine is one of Carnival's "old new" liners, representing a truly grandiose ship transformation project. The old Carnival Destiny ship (built 1996) was extensively (and expensively) drydock refitted and refurbished in Europe (Trieste Italy) at the astonishing cost of USD 155 million. The vessel was transformed into a brand new Carnival "Fun Ship 2.0" in 2013 under the sunny and shiny name "Carnival Sunshine". MS Carnival Destiny had as sisters the Carnival ships Triumph (Sunrise since 2019) and Victory (Radiance since 2020), and also Costa Fortuna and Costa Magica.
The Sunshine ship's interior design was done by Partner Design (german company based in Hamburg). Destiny ship's interior design was by Joe Francus. The new ship now features modern amenities, new venues, more dining options, new onboard entertainment program (3 new grand show productions).
As Destiny-class liner, Carnival Destiny-Sunshine is world's first cruise ship to weight over 100,000 tons. First cruise (as Destiny) was on November 24, 1996. The inaugural cruise (as Sunshine) started April 12, 2013 (14-day Mediterranean Venice-Barcelona).
Carnival Destiny's list of chartered/themed voyages includes the first-ever "311 Caribbean Cruise" (March 2011), the first-ever "Kiss Kruise" (October 2011) and the first-ever "Weezer Cruise" (January 2012).
Carnival Destiny-Sunshine refurbishment 2013 conversion review
The most extensively-expensive of all (ever) was the Carnival Destiny's drydock refit/transformation. At the staggering cost of USD 155 million, this really extreme makeover produced a brand new Carnival ship in 2013! After its last dry-dock ever (a 49-day refurbishment), the Destiny ship emerged as Carnival Sunshine. This amazing cruise ship transformation was made in the Fincantieri shipyard (Monfalcone, Italy) adding a new partial deck and 2 other decks (in the front section). As a result of the Carnival Destiny renovation, 182 new cabins were added (including 96 spa cabins), all of the ship's other cabins were also refurbished (with a new tropical decor). The list of all major changes includes:
- a new Asian restaurant (casual dining venue)
- "The Comfort Kitchen" (in the Lido Marketplace)
- the "Havana Bar" (Lido Marketplace) with floor to ceiling windows
- the "Sunshine Bar" (Atrium)
- a new cigar club
- the first-ever 3-deck-high Carnival Serenity retreat (an adults-only area) with the Carnival Cloud 9 Spa package.
- the "SportSquare" (an open-air complex with a ropes course, a minigolf course, and a half-size basketball-volleyball court.
During drydock 2018 (October 14-21, in Freeport Bahamas) were made regularly planned maintenance works. Drydock 2016 was in the period March 8-20.
